			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-208" style="margin: 3px;" title="question" src="http://blogs.missoulafcu.org/mfcu/wp-content/uploads/2009/04/question.gif" alt="question" width="100" height="200" />We&#8217;ve had a few questions from our members about why we&#8217;re constructing a new building in the midst of a down economy.</p>
<p>This project has been part of our strategic plan for the past 4 years. Our Board and Management saw several years ago that we would be in need of upgraded, additional facilities in the coming years and prudently began planning for it by building up our capital and exploring a variety of options to fill our needs.</p>
<p>The time has come and we have literally run out of room. We have staff temporarily housed in the basement at Fairway who will be losing their office space when that lease runs out next year. We have filled the Southside Branch to overflowing and need to hire additional back office staff, but have no place to put them. We have departments split up and working in different locations… all of which can impact the speed and efficiency of the service we are able to provide our members. This is unacceptable to our Board and Management, hence the construction project. We will be remodeling the current Southside Branch building, adding a two-story building (with basement) to the front of it and turning the Training Center back into a drive up facility with 6 updated teller tubes, 2 ATMs and a night drop. (This will double our drive up capacity and reduce wait times for our members.)</p>
<p>This is actually a GREAT time for us to build. Prices have declined significantly since we started planning the project (down nearly $2 million!) so we are getting an even better deal for our members. Construction has come to a significant slow-down, so we are providing a “local stimulus” by keeping local contractors employed through these difficult times. Whenever possible we have used local (Missoula and W. MT) contractors. Some services (steel fabrication for example) are not available locally, so we had to go outside the area for that. We have used a local architectural and engineering firm and a local general contractor.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-200" style="margin: 3px;" title="ss1" src="http://blogs.missoulafcu.org/mfcu/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/ss1.gif" alt="ss1" width="215" height="141" />The dust has barely settled from our Russell branch construction, but we just can&#8217;t wait any longer to start our next project. Our branch at 3600 Brooks (the &#8216;Southside&#8217; branch) will be getting a major facelift over the next year. And the first phase of that project is about to begin.</p>
<p><span style="color: #993300;"><strong>Phase 1:</strong> </span>During the last week of March, work will begin on the building that has been acting as our Training Center, just east of the Southside branch. We&#8217;re going to convert that building back into a functioning drive-up, complete with video links to the tellers inside.</p>
<p>Part of this first phase of work will also involve cutting a door into the south side of our current branch (closest to Dore Lane) to allow access to the existing lobby during construction.</p>
<p><span style="color: #993300;"><strong>Phase 2:</strong></span> We&#8217;ll build a two-story (plus basement) addition on the north side of the existing building (closest to Brooks). This addition will allow more of our administration to work in one spot, which will certainly make it a whole lot more efficient. This phase will take the longest, but it will be the most visible change.</p>
<p><strong><span style="color: #993300;">Phase 3:</span></strong> Once the front part of the new building is complete, we&#8217;ll convert the current building (which by then will be the &#8216;old&#8217; building) into a training center. The new facility will allow us to expand our current seminar offerings, and hopefully give us a spot where our entire staff can meet at once.</p>
<p>We&#8217;ll try to keep everything accessible and moving during this project, but it will be a tad disruptive. Please watch for signs to direct you, or feel free to visit our other branches.</p>
